...week after Mrs. Hamer's plea, Harrison Wellford, teaching fellow in Government, was able to send her the $1300--plus an undisclosed surplus--from collections in Cambridge. With the money, the co-op was able to beat the option deadline and keep the land from being sold to a white planter...
...money came in from all over--from Cambridge, from Boston, from New York, and from many other places," Wellford said on Monday. "Lawyers, brokers, doctors, and professors mailed in checks." Wellford said he had received one check for $450 in the mail, plus "$260 in nickels and dimes from black and white children at the Friends' School in Cambridge...
